Designed by Ferdinand Porsche, arguably the most talented automotive engineer of the 20th century, the SSK, short for Super Sport Kurz, broke ground in a number of technical areas including horsepower, a cutting edge transmission and top speed (120 mph). The SSK was the last car that Herr Porsche designed for Mercedes Benz before moving on and starting the Porsche Company. The car is a testament to his engineering and design genius.
